Introduction: The Growing Demand for Dental Hygienist assistants in 2024
Dental hygienist assistants play a crucial role in maintaining oral health by supporting dentists and dental hygienists during procedures, managing patient care, and ensuring the smooth operation of dental practices. As the healthcare industry continues to expand, especially with an aging population and increased focus on preventive dental care, demand for skilled dental assistants is projected to rise considerably in 2024.

Core Skills Required for Aspiring Dental Hygienist Assistants
1. Excellent Communication Skills
Being able to communicate effectively with patients and team members is fundamental. Clear communication fosters patient comfort, ensures understanding of instructions, and enhances team collaboration.
2. Technical Proficiency
Proficiency with dental equipment, sterilization techniques, and clinical procedures is essential. Staying updated with modern dental technologies and tools will distinguish you from other candidates.
3. Attention to Detail
Accuracy in recording patient data, handling instruments, and following safety protocols prevents errors and ensures high-quality patient care.
4. Compassion and Patient Care Skills
Empathy and patience are vital to creating a positive experience for patients, especially those anxious about dental procedures.
5. Organizational and Time Management Skills
Balancing multiple patients and tasks requires strong organizational abilities to maintain efficiency and punctuality.
6. Knowledge of Dental Health Practices and Regulations
Understanding dental anatomy, infection control standards, and legal regulations ensures compliance and safety in the dental setting.
Practical Tips to Enhance Your Career Prospects in 2024
- Obtain Accredited Certification: Completing a recognized dental assisting program can boost your credibility and job prospects.
- Gain Hands-On Experience: Internships or volunteering at dental clinics provide invaluable practical skills.
- Stay Updated with industry Trends: Follow dental associations,attend workshops,and engage in continuous learning.
- Develop Soft Skills: Focus on improving communication, empathy, and teamwork skills for better patient interactions and workplace relationships.
- Use Technology Effectively: Familiarize yourself with electronic health records (EHR) systems and dental imaging tools.

Case Study: A Day in the Life of a Dental Hygienist Assistant in 2024
| Time | activity | Skills Demonstrated |
|---|---|---|
| 8:00 AM | Preparing sterilized instruments and setting up treatment rooms | Attention to detail,organization |
| 9:00 AM | Assisting during patient cleanings and X-ray procedures | Technical proficiency,patient communication |
| 11:00 AM | Managing patient records and updating health histories | Organizational skills,data accuracy |
| 1:00 PM | Assisting in sterilization and infection control protocols | Knowledge of safety standards |
| 3:00 PM | Providing post-procedure instructions and answering patient questions | Communication,empathy |
